• 検索結果がありません。

一番はじめのプログラミング

プログラミング学習普及プロジェクトの 取り組みについて 愛知県立緑丘商業高等学校教諭 中村和人 はじめに Google 日本法人は平成 25 年 10 月, コンピュータに親しもう と題する, 日本のコンピュータサイエンス教育を支援する プログラミング学習普及プロジェクト Programming E

プログラミング学習普及プロジェクトの 取り組みについて 愛知県立緑丘商業高等学校教諭 中村和人 はじめに Google 日本法人は平成 25 年 10 月, コンピュータに親しもう と題する, 日本のコンピュータサイエンス教育を支援する プログラミング学習普及プロジェクト Programming E

... はじめに Google 日本法人は平成 25 年 10 月,「コンピュ ータに親しもう」と題する,日本コンピュータ サイエンス教育を支援する「プログラミング学習 普 及 プ ロ ジ ェ ク ト 」Programming Education Gathering(以下 PEG と言う)を開始した。 Google 会長 Eric Schmidt 氏は 「日本はサイ ...

5

はじめようプログラミング 「アルゴロジック」「1時間で学ぶソフトウエアの仕組み」を経て、JavaScriptへ

はじめようプログラミング 「アルゴロジック」「1時間で学ぶソフトウエアの仕組み」を経て、JavaScriptへ

...  次回学習するプログラミングの前に 経験して欲しい 「 アルゴリズム 」を 体験・理解する.. 能城茂雄 http://noshiro.shigeo.jp/..[r] ...

61

研究紀要第 79 号 令和元年度 1 外国語活動 外国語部会文部科学省が目指す小学校外国語教育の理解と小中連携への意欲につながる研究実践 2 プログラミング教育部会プログラミング的思考を育む授業実践 ~ プログラミング授業実践はじめの一歩 ~ 3 個人研究及び教材 教具創作品の部 佐賀市教育委員会佐

研究紀要第 79 号 令和元年度 1 外国語活動 外国語部会文部科学省が目指す小学校外国語教育の理解と小中連携への意欲につながる研究実践 2 プログラミング教育部会プログラミング的思考を育む授業実践 ~ プログラミング授業実践はじめの一歩 ~ 3 個人研究及び教材 教具創作品の部 佐賀市教育委員会佐

... 6 (エ) 単元考察 本単元で育成すべき資質・能力に,「物語楽しさを知り,読書に親しむこと」を挙げてい た。しかし,この指導事項では,付けるべき力があまりに大枠で,曖昧になってしまっていた。 ここでは, 「語まとまりに気を付けて音読すること」を育成すべき資質・能力とすべきであり, ...

79

競技プログラミングと初等整数論入門 67 回生佐竹俊哉 1. はじめに 初めまして satashun と申します 普段はのんびり数学やプログラミングをして楽しんでいます 自分は主にプログラミングの中でも 特に決められた時間の中で問題を解く競技プログラミングというものに興味を持っています そのようなプ

競技プログラミングと初等整数論入門 67 回生佐竹俊哉 1. はじめに 初めまして satashun と申します 普段はのんびり数学やプログラミングをして楽しんでいます 自分は主にプログラミングの中でも 特に決められた時間の中で問題を解く競技プログラミングというものに興味を持っています そのようなプ

... これは、n 約数 1 つを d とすると、n / d が整数かつ n 約 数となり、n > sqrt(n), n / d > sqrt(n)と仮定した場合には、両辺 を掛けると n > n となってしまって矛盾することから分かります。 これで素数判定や素因数分解などがそれなりに高速にできるよう になりました。 ...

22

JavaScriptプログラミング入門 2.JavaScriptの概要

JavaScriptプログラミング入門 2.JavaScriptの概要

... インスタンスメソッドとクラスメソッド ・getHours()ようなメソッドは、あらかじめ生成されているインスタンスに 対して実行される。インスタンスが管理するデータは個々インスタンス ごとに異なるため、以下ようにオブジェクト型名であるDateに対して メソッドを呼び出すことはできない。 ...

34

プログラミング教育における指導方法の検証

プログラミング教育における指導方法の検証

... いるようで,会計簿に現れる数値先頭数字 出現頻度に着目し,処理が適正かどうか,ね つ造されていないかをチェックするために活用 しているとことである[14]。かなり広い範 囲で成り立つ法則ようなので[12],自然現 象や社会現象に現れる生データでチェックし てみるも,魅力的な教材になるではないか ...

6

RobotCでの基本プログラミング

RobotCでの基本プログラミング

... 1. はじめに LEGO MINDSTORMS とはレゴ社が MIT(米国マサチューセッツ工科大学)と共同開発した, ロボティクス先駆的な製品であり,NXT(ロボット頭脳に相当)と呼ばれるマイクロプロセ ッサが組み込まれたインテリジェントブロックを含むキットである(図 1 参照).NXT には USB ポート,4つ入力ポート(センサ用) ...

14

初めてのプログラミング

初めてのプログラミング

... 状態)」から、「黒い十字」へと変わります。この黒い十字は、左ドラッグによって選択領域を広げられる状態であ ることを示します。この状態で、マウス左クリックして、下にドラッグしてみます(Fig. 1-3 (a) 状態)。 A7 までドラッグしたら、マウスボタンを離します。すると、1 から 6 まで数字が現れます(Fig. 1-3 (b))。この操 作により、3 から 6 ...

9

2004/11/23 オブジェクト指向プログラミング - モデル図とシーケンス図の表現方法 - オブジェクト指向プログラミング (OOP:ObjectOrientedPrograming) オブジェクト指向プログラミング言語 (OOPL) Java,C++,Delphi(Pascal),Visual

2004/11/23 オブジェクト指向プログラミング - モデル図とシーケンス図の表現方法 - オブジェクト指向プログラミング (OOP:ObjectOrientedPrograming) オブジェクト指向プログラミング言語 (OOPL) Java,C++,Delphi(Pascal),Visual

... オブジェクト指向に基づきプログラム開発を行う場合では,これまで手続き型プログラム作成で持ちられて きた PDL やフローチャートはほとんど利用されない。 プログラムや処理流れを表現する記述方法(図)として、いくつか図が提案されている。 (これら図は規格化されており,まとめて UML (Unified Modeling Language) ...

9

スパコンに通じる並列プログラミングの基礎

スパコンに通じる並列プログラミングの基礎

... 阪大スーパーコンピュータ (SX-ACE) はベクトル型計算機を束ねたものな ので,1 ノード (1 cpu, 4 core) でおさまる計算ならばテクニック的には難し いことはない.ベクトル化率を高める為工夫はまた別に必要だが. 実は普通 PC でも 4 コア持っていたりするので,4 倍ぐらいまで並列化 は容易にできたりする. ...

59

2012年夏のプログラミング・シンポジウム.indd

2012年夏のプログラミング・シンポジウム.indd

... Beautiful Code へ王道や万能薬は存在しない. 一旦動いたプログラムを何度も見直し 短く改良する余地が ないか探す. 未完プログラムを改良し始めてはいけない. 寝ても覚めても電車で立っていても考え続ける. 時にはまったく違う方向から解法を試みる. プログラムすべき問題理解が正しいか反省する. プログラ ムが複雑に見える時は必ず改良できる. ...

8

Rプログラミング

Rプログラミング

... ファイルは,R データファイルようにプログラムから利用しやすいように整形済み データを格納したものなので,オプション等をつけずに単純に読み込めばデータフレームとして読 み込まれる.ここでは実際にファイルを読み込むことはしないが,読み込み方だけ以下に説明する. Stata ファイル読み込みに使う ...

16

ネットワークプログラミング

ネットワークプログラミング

... (データが要求したぶんだけまだ到着していないなど) 必ずcountバイト読んだあとリターンするようにしたければ そのようにプログラムする必要がある。 デフォルトでは読むデータがない場合は読めるまでブロックする (そこでプログラム動作が止まる) ...

71

ネットワークプログラミング

ネットワークプログラミング

... ビットシフト、マスク • ヘッダ情報、データデコード際に必要になること がある。 • ビットを節約するため等理由により、1バイト内に 意味が違うデータが入っている場合にビットシフト、 マスク等を使用してデータを取り出すことが必要で ある場合がある。 ...

81

プログラミング 1 プログラミング演習 I プログラミングの重要性 プログラミング言語をなぜ勉強するのか? 世界的に有名な日本のある IT 企業の社長が求める人材に 必要なスキル 1. プログラミング (C 言語 ) 2. 数学 3. 英語 #-1 #-2 プログラミングはどこで使えるのか? 1.

プログラミング 1 プログラミング演習 I プログラミングの重要性 プログラミング言語をなぜ勉強するのか? 世界的に有名な日本のある IT 企業の社長が求める人材に 必要なスキル 1. プログラミング (C 言語 ) 2. 数学 3. 英語 #-1 #-2 プログラミングはどこで使えるのか? 1.

... プログラミングプログラミングプログラミングプログラミングプログラミング演習I プログラミング演習II プログラミングプログラミングプログラミングプログラミングプログラミング演習I ...

7

「今、一番得するマイレージ」4.0

「今、一番得するマイレージ」4.0

... 貯まらないは容易に想像がつくと思います。 ただし、電気屋場合は貯まったポイントを 1 ポイントから使えるので有効期限 さえ気をつければいわゆる死にポイント(貯めたけど使えないポイント)が発生 する可能性は低いですが、航空会社マイル場合は最低でも 10,000 マイル 程度は貯めないと無料航空券や景品等に交換することができず、また基本的 ...

68

C プログラミング 1( 再 ) 第 4 回 講義では C プログラミングの基本を学び 演習では やや実践的なプログラミングを通して学ぶ 1

C プログラミング 1( 再 ) 第 4 回 講義では C プログラミングの基本を学び 演習では やや実践的なプログラミングを通して学ぶ 1

... なぜ関数を作るか 関数を組み合わせて、より複雑な仕事ができるようにする 確実に動く関数から、複雑な動きをする関数に発展させる 大きな仕事を一つ関数で書く(作る)よりも、 ...

22

プログラミング 1 ( 第 1 回 ) 卓上プログラミングによる開発設計概観 Python インタプリタの起動と逐次処理 変数の利用 1. プログラミングとは何か? 1. プログラムの特徴 2. ( プログラミングにおける2 大原則 ) 3. ( プログラミングを円滑に進めるための周辺技術 ) 2.

プログラミング 1 ( 第 1 回 ) 卓上プログラミングによる開発設計概観 Python インタプリタの起動と逐次処理 変数の利用 1. プログラミングとは何か? 1. プログラムの特徴 2. ( プログラミングにおける2 大原則 ) 3. ( プログラミングを円滑に進めるための周辺技術 ) 2.

... • 来たるべき、「みんな」コードために:平成 4年生ま れがつくるプログラマー学校 , http://wired.jp/2016/03/04/kusano-teacher/ • 20歳を過ぎてからプログラミングを学ぼうと決めた人 たちへ , http://www.slideshare.net/ShuUesugi/20- ...

51

初めてのプログラミング

初めてのプログラミング

... までコピーします。コピー方法としては、先ほどと同様、B2 セル を選択して、右下部分を B12 まで左ドラッグしてください。 3.絶対参照方法 先ほどは、相対参照により式参照先が自動的に変更されることを学びました。しかし、場合によっ ては、参照先が自動的に変更されないようにした方が良いこともあります。このことを、絶対参照と呼 ...

8

2012年夏のプログラミング・シンポジウム.indd

2012年夏のプログラミング・シンポジウム.indd

... 1) 8 章では画像処理 ためその場コード生成について述べられている.引 数を多く持つが,処理中はそれら値が定数であるよ うな関数が,画像処理ではよく現れる.例として与え られた二つ入力ビットマップデータから,ピクセル 単位で論理演算をして新しいビットマップデータを出 力する BitBlt ...

10

Show all 10000 documents...

関連した話題